Intravenous therapy (IVT) is a medical process that delivers medicines, liquids as well as nutrients straight to the bloodstream of an individual. The intravenous pathway of medicine delivery is frequently used for hydration or for replenishing nutrients that are not absorbed appropriately by the body from food and beverages.
